What are the Most Common injuries in youth baseball?

What are the most common injuries in youth baseball?

Injuries are usually overuse in nature and occur most commonly to the head and face. But the most common overuse problems are in the shoulder and elbow. Rotator cuff tendinitis and shoulder instability. Little League Elbow or chronic strain of the ligaments or muscles on the inside part of the elbow are also common overuse problems. Treatment of these problems centers on periods of rest from the sport, strengthening, stretching, and working on throwing mechanics. Overall fitness, leg strength, hamstring flexibility, and core strength all contribute to the proper throwing as well as injury prevention.
